Step One: Define Your Goals

The first step in creating your personal development framework is to define your goals. Your goals should be specific, measurable, achievable, relevant, and time-bound. This means that you should set goals that are realistic, meaningful, and have a specific timeline.

To help you define your goals, ask yourself the following questions:

– What do you want to achieve?
– Why is this important to you?
– What challenges do you think you may face?
– What resources do you need to achieve your goals?

By answering these questions, you’ll be able to create a clear and concise roadmap for achieving your personal development goals.

Step Two: Develop an Action Plan

Once you’ve defined your goals, the next step is to develop an action plan. Your action plan should outline the specific actions you need to take to achieve your goals. This may include developing new skills, changing your habits, or seeking the help of a mentor or coach.

To create an effective action plan, consider the following:

– Break your goals down into manageable tasks.
– Identify potential obstacles and develop strategies to overcome them.
– Set deadlines for each task to help keep you motivated.

Remember that your action plan should be flexible and adaptable to your changing needs, goals, and priorities.

Step Three: Staying Accountable

Creating a personal development framework is only half the battle. Staying accountable and following through on your goals is essential to your success. Fortunately, there are several strategies you can use to stay accountable.

– Share your goals with someone you trust.
– Track your progress regularly.
– Celebrate your successes, no matter how small.

Staying accountable will not only help you achieve your goals but also build your self-confidence and resilience.

Step Four: Continuously Learning

Personal growth is a lifelong journey. The most successful people are those who continue to learn and grow throughout their lives.

To continue learning and growing, consider the following:

– Read books, attend seminars, or take courses in areas that interest you.
– Seek feedback from others and be open to constructive criticism.
– Always be willing to try new things and take risks.

By continually learning and growing, you’ll not only achieve your current goals but also set yourself up for long-term success.
